COVID-19 booster clinic on campus Tuesday, Feb. 8

Stoner Health & Counseling Center, in conjunction with the Seneca County General Health District, will offer a COVID-19 booster clinic on campus on Tuesday, Feb. 8, from 11 a.m.-1 p.m. in Campus Center 120.

Eligibility

•     If you received your second Pfizer or Moderna vaccine more than 5 months ago, you are eligible for the booster.
•    If you received your Johnson & Johnson single dose vaccine more than 2 months ago, you are eligible for the booster.
 
Booster types available

All three boosters (Moderna, Pfizer and Johnson & Johnson) will be available.
 
Appointments required

If you are planning to get your booster on campus on February 8, you will need to make an advance appointment. Please use this form to indicate your preferred time and booster type. 

Bring the following documents with you to your appointment:

•    Photo ID
•    Your insurance card
•    Your shot record, so the Health Department can verify your booster eligibility. They will not be able to administer the booster without proof of primary series vaccine completion and dates.
 
Provide documentation

Please remember to provide documentation of your booster to Human Resources (for employees) or the Health Center (for students). If you have already received your booster and provided documentation to Heidelberg, you do not need to do anything further.
